Discover the time-honored tradition of Christmas tamales making, which begins on December 12th, with the Feast of Our Lady of Guadalupe and culminates on Epiphany, January 6th. Throughout this festive season, tamaladas, tamale making parties, bring families and friends together to make Christmas tamales with a variety of fillings. Join Chef Miriam as she gives step-by-step instruction on how to make savory Red Pork Tamales and Tamales de Rajas con Queso, tamales stuffed with queso fresco and poblano peppers. You’ll also get to try Mexican Atole, a warm and creamy traditional hot Mexican beverage that is thickened with masa, sweetened with piloncillo, and flavored with cinnamon.
